An epic story of the nineteen-thirties'' Depression which traces the story of one destitute family among the thousands who fled the Dust Bowl to the promise of California, THE GRAPES OF WRATH awakened the conscience of a nation. Awarded the Pulitzer Prize on its appearance in 1939, Steinbeck''s novel has been compared in its impact and influence with UNCLE TOM''S CABIN. |
